✅ Short Answer: NO! Defaulting on a Loan is NOT a Criminal Offence!
Under Indian law, non-repayment of loans is a civil offence, NOT a criminal one! 🚫🚔 #DebtLaw #LoanDefaulter
🔍 When Can Legal Action Be Taken Against You?
✔ If You Issue a Bounced Cheque – Under Section 138 of the NI Act, cheque bounce can lead to legal trouble! ⚠️📜 #ChequeBounceCase
✔ If You Took a Loan with Fraudulent Intent – Providing fake documents or cheating the lender is a criminal offence! 🚨🏛️ #LoanFraud
✔ If a Court Orders Repayment & You Ignore It – Courts can attach assets or issue recovery orders! 📩⚖️ #DebtRecoveryProcess
❌ When You CANNOT Be Jailed for a Loan Default?
❌ If You Genuinely Can’t Pay Due to Financial Issues – No criminal case, but banks may seize collateral/assets! 🏦🔒 #DebtRelief
❌ If You Are in Negotiation with the Lender – Banks prefer settlements over legal battles! 🤝📑 #LoanSettlement
❌ If It’s an Unsecured Personal Loan – Lenders can’t force jail time for unpaid personal loans! 🚫🏛️ #CivilDispute
🏆 What Can a Borrower Do?
✅ Request Loan Restructuring – Banks may extend repayment terms! 🏦📉 #DebtRestructure
✅ Settle Through Mediation – Negotiating can reduce legal complications! ⚖️🤝 #LoanSettlementPlan
✅ Seek Legal Help – Protect yourself from harassment & illegal recovery tactics! 🏛️🛑 #DebtProtection
